dblink_get_notify
Synopsis
dblink_get_notify() returns setof (notify_name text, be_pid int, extra text) dblink_get_notify(text connname) returns setof (notify_name text, be_pid int, extra text)
Description
  
   dblink_get_notify
  
  retrieves notifications on either
    the unnamed connection, or on a named connection if specified.
    To receive notifications via dblink,
  
   LISTEN
  
  must
    first be issued, using
  
   dblink_exec
  
  .
    For details see
  
   LISTEN
  
  and
  
   NOTIFY
  
  .
 
Examples
SELECT dblink_exec('LISTEN virtual');
 dblink_exec 
-------------
 LISTEN
(1 row)
SELECT * FROM dblink_get_notify();
 notify_name | be_pid | extra
-------------+--------+-------
(0 rows)
NOTIFY virtual;
NOTIFY
SELECT * FROM dblink_get_notify();
 notify_name | be_pid | extra
-------------+--------+-------
 virtual     |   1229 |
(1 row)
